Taking the fastest route
Your Mazda NB1 regularly looks for a faster route to your destination. If the traffic situation chang-
es and a faster route is found, your Mazda NB1 will offer to replan your trip so you can use the
faster route.
You can also set your Mazda NB1 to automatically replan your trip whenever a faster route is
found. To apply this setting, tap Traffic settings in the Traffic menu.
To manually find and replan the fastest route to your destination, do the following:
1. Tap the traffic sidebar.
Tip: If you find that tapping the sidebar opens the Main menu instead of the traffic menu, try
tapping the sidebar with your finger resting on the edge of the screen.
A summary of traffic on your route is shown.
2. Tap Options.
3. Tap Minimize delays.
Your Mazda NB1 searches for the fastest route to your destination.
The new route may include traffic delays. You can replan the route to avoid all traffic delays,
but a route which avoids all delays will usually take longer than the fastest route.
4. Tap Done.
